Investing Strategies for Career-Driven Individuals

For driven professionals, growing wealth requires a tailored approach to investing. Standard strategies often fall short when time is scarce due to demanding careers. Consider prioritizing a blend of hands-off investments like index funds , which present diversification and minimal management effort . Alternatively, explore property investment trusts (REITs) for exposure to the housing market without the hassle of direct ownership. Keep in mind that consistent contributions, even small amounts, combined with a patient perspective, can generate significant returns over time. Here's a quick look at some options:


  • Target Date Funds: These progressively adjust asset distribution as you approach your goals .
  • Robo-Advisors: Online platforms that manage your investments for a nominal fee.
  • Dividend Stocks: Firms that issue a portion of their profits to owners.

Retirement Planning for High-Earning Professionals

For affluent professionals making a significant income, pension planning requires a specialized approach. Simply relying on standard strategies is often lacking to ensure a comfortable and financially independent post-career period. Thorough consideration must be given to leveraging company-provided plans like 401(k)s, while also exploring additional investment options, such as real estate, to accumulate a substantial retirement fund and mitigate tax implications. Engaging a qualified financial advisor is vital for designing a customized plan that matches with individual objectives and risk tolerance.

Navigating Career Transitions with a Solid Financial Plan

Embarking beginning a job transition can be stressful , but possessing a robust financial plan is critical for a smooth process . Meticulously assessing your existing finances – such as savings , debts , and ongoing costs – allows you to realistically estimate the consequence of a job change . Furthermore , establishing a spending plan which includes a anticipated earnings decline and unforeseen fees will provide a buffer and enable you throughout the career move .
